Why Solar Systems Often Fail to Deliver

Many homeowners invest in solar panels expecting instant savings, only to discover that real performance can be inconsistent. Cloud cover, seasonal changes, shading from trees, and inefficient wiring can reduce output even when the panels visionenergy are technically functioning. On top of that, energy demand in a home rarely matches the sun’s schedule, so excess generation may go unused or be exported at less favourable rates.

Another common issue is a lack of visibility. Without monitoring, it’s hard to tell whether a system is underperforming due to inverter problems, battery limitations, or simple installer mismatch. When data is missing, problems are noticed late, and the fix can be more expensive than prevention. This uncertainty is precisely where smart planning and system control can change the outcome.

How Smart Management Solves the Performance Gap

A problem-solution approach starts with accurate measurement and intelligent control of how power moves through the home. Smart energy solutions can track solar output, grid usage, battery state, and household consumption in a single view. With that clarity, you can identify patterns such as morning spikes, evening surges, or recurring shading effects that reduce production. Instead of guessing, you gain an evidence-based way to improve efficiency.

Control also means better decision-making about when to store energy and when to use it. By aligning battery charging with surplus solar generation, homeowners can reduce reliance on the grid during high-demand periods. Advanced management can prioritize essential loads, support peak-time strategies, and help maintain stable performance even when generation fluctuates. The result is smoother, more reliable solar use that better matches how people actually live.

What to Look for in a Visionenergy-Driven Setup

To get dependable results, the system design should consider both present needs and future upgrades. A good setup balances panel capacity, inverter capability, and battery sizing so that stored energy is meaningful rather than marginal. It should also include monitoring that supports action, not just reporting—clear alerts for drop-offs, simple performance indicators, and accessible historical trends. When these elements work together, optimization becomes an ongoing process rather than a one-time installation.

Service quality matters as much as hardware. Trusted support can help homeowners understand installation choices, roof constraints, and electrical integration, reducing risk from day one. A reliable provider can also guide the best operating strategy for export and self-consumption, depending on tariff structure and household usage.
